Being out of excuses to postpone this release, we are releasing PowerDNS Authoritative Server version 5.1.0 today.
A detailed list of changes can be found in the changelog.
There are too many changes and bugfixes to mention in this short announcement; among the new features, you might be interested in structured logging or, for users of the LMDB backend, the ability to add comments to their RRsets, a feature which used to be available on SQL backends only.

Note that per our End of Life policy, the release of the final 5.1.0 version marks the end of support for version 4.8. However, users with a commercial agreement with PowerDNS.COM BV or Open-Xchange can receive support for releases which are End Of Life. If you are such a user, this EOL statement does not apply to you.
